Business Growth Strategies

  1. Optimize Your Company Page: Ensure your company page is complete and up-to-date. Use a professional logo and a compelling banner image. Share regular updates about your products, services, and company culture.
  2. Engage with Content: Publish thought leadership articles to demonstrate your expertise. Share industry news and insights to keep your audience informed. Use videos and infographics to capture attention and engage viewers.
  3. Join and Create Groups: Participate in relevant LinkedIn Groups to network and share knowledge. Create your own group to establish your company as an industry leader and facilitate discussions.

Personal Growth Strategies

  1. Optimize Your Profile: Use a professional headshot and a clear, concise headline. Write a compelling summary that highlights your skills, experiences, and career goals. Add your accomplishments, certifications, and projects to showcase your expertise.
  2. Expand Your Network: Connect with colleagues, industry leaders, and professionals you admire. Personalize connection requests to increase the likelihood of acceptance. Engage with your connections’ posts by liking, commenting, and sharing.
  3. Share Your Insights: Post regular updates about your professional activities and insights. Write articles on topics you’re passionate about to establish yourself as a thought leader. Use multimedia content to make your posts more engaging.
  4. Seek Recommendations and Endorsements: Request recommendations from colleagues and clients to add credibility to your profile. Endorse others’ skills, and they’re likely to return the favor.

Success Stories

Case Study 1: Small Business Expansion A small marketing agency used LinkedIn to connect with potential clients and showcase their work. By regularly posting case studies and engaging with industry groups, they saw a 40% increase in inbound inquiries within six months.

Case Study 2: Personal Brand Enhancement A software developer leveraged LinkedIn to share coding tutorials and industry insights. This not only enhanced their personal brand but also led to several speaking opportunities at tech conferences.
